A company backed by Tether has just announced a significant acquisition of roughly half a billion dollars’ worth of BTC. Rise in Cryptocurrency With institutional demand rapidly increasing, the number of major Bitcoin $ 104,616 -investing companies is also on the rise. Strategy is preparing to make acquisitions worth tens of billions of dollars. This year, Charles Schwab will launch cryptocurrency services. BlackRock and others are expanding their crypto ETF offerings. Today, Twenty One revealed it purchased 4,812 BTC for $458 million, at a cost of $95,319 per BTC. Aiming to build a vast reserve, this Tether-backed company plans to become a giant on the scale of Strategy. Cantor Equity Partners had announced on April 22, 2025, within the Business Merger Agreement, that purchases would be made, and steps in that direction have begun. More acquisitions may be seen in the days and weeks ahead.
